I don't really have any info about samsung tablets, but as someone who got an ipad for studying, I would absolutely recommend it, I have the ipad 10th gen, and even while being the most affordable out of their whole range, I have never had any issues, it really helps to have a stylus, i have the apple pencil but my friend who got an affordable stylus says it works really well. Notability is really good app for both handwritten notes and typed notes, the files app is great for sorting pdf notes etc, and if you have a stylus you can practically write on any document, (i use the files app to solve past papers and add stuff to pdf notes and stuff but if you find it easier to export them onto notability and solve it there, that's perfectly fine too), also, i would really recommend getting one with a higher storage, i have 256 gb. Plus, you can also attach a keyboard and mouse with it if that's what you prefer, i have the logitech pebble k380 keyboard and the logitech pebble mouse, both work perfectly fine but i honestly don't have much use for the keyboard and mouse, it's just a matter of preference
